How much do lab jobs pay per hour?

As of May 31, 2026, the average hourly pay for lab in Hackensack, NJ is $27.54,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.96 and $30.43 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Laboratory Technician,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Laboratory Technician, you need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a background in biology or chemistry, typically supported by an associate or bachelor's degree in a related field. Familiarity with laboratory equipment, safety protocols, and data management software such as LIMS (Laboratory Information Management Systems) is essential. Strong organizational skills, effective communication, and the ability to work both independently and as part of a team distinguish top performers in this role. These skills ensure accurate testing, reliable results, and a safe, efficient laboratory environment.

What are some typical daily responsibilities for someone working in a laboratory setting?

In a laboratory role, daily responsibilities often include preparing and analyzing samples, maintaining accurate records of experiments, calibrating and cleaning equipment, and following strict safety protocols. Team members may also assist with data analysis, report findings, and collaborate with researchers or other departments to support ongoing projects. Effective communication and attention to detail are essential, as lab work often contributes directly to larger research or production goals.

What are lab technicians?

Lab technicians are professionals who perform laboratory tests and procedures to assist scientists, doctors, or researchers in analyzing samples and conducting experiments. They work in various settings, such as hospitals, research facilities, and industrial labs, handling tasks like preparing specimens, operating lab equipment, and recording data. Their work is essential for diagnosing diseases, supporting scientific research, and ensuring the quality of products.

What is the difference between Lab vs Medical Laboratory Technician?

AspectLabMedical Laboratory Technician
CredentialsVaries; often includes certifications or degrees in laboratory sciencesTypically requires an associate degree in medical laboratory technology and certification
Work EnvironmentResearch labs, industrial labs, academic institutionsHospitals, clinics, healthcare facilities
Employer & IndustryResearch institutions, biotech companies, universitiesHealthcare providers, hospitals, diagnostic labs
Common Search & ComparisonLab vs Medical Laboratory Technician

While both roles involve laboratory work, 'Lab' is a broad term that can refer to various types of laboratories, including research and industrial settings. Medical Laboratory Technicians specifically work in healthcare environments, performing diagnostic tests to assist in patient care. The key differences lie in their work settings, required credentials, and industry focus.
